The other Ten Negritos
‘Identidad’ is a kind of modern rereading of ‘Diez Negritos’, the classic by Christie Agatha that has already been brought to the big screen on several occasions. This time ten strangers are forced to take refuge in a motel in the middle of nowhere, but things get even more complicated when it becomes clear that one of them has to be a murderer.
With that premise, the screenwriter michael cooney builds a story that prioritizes thriller over terror, also leaving enough space for us to meet the characters and understand their motivations. In addition, it uses a peculiar structure to give ‘Identity’ a different energy, something that Mangold knows how to take advantage of very well to always maintain a climate of intrigue in which not everything depends on simply solving the mystery around the corpses that accumulate.
It helps to have a first class cast with many faces known to the public as John Cusack, Ray Liotta or Amanda Peet. None of them a great star, but all very competent whenever they wanted to, which was key to giving extra solidity to a film called to surprise the viewer, although later it will depend on each one how to take it. There will be those who see it as something brilliant, while others will not tire of using the term cheater.
For my part, I tend more towards the positive in that aspect, but on top of that it is a very entertaining film that knows how to dose suspense very wellhas an effective setting work with which it is impossible not to remember at some point ‘Psychosis’, a film with which it also shares some other point in common.
